Last Arrival

Last Arrival is a pan-fandom, original character friendly game set in a post-apocalyptic world where history has been mostly forgotten. Your character arrives from their world and to get home, they're going to have to help piece together what happened in this one. Be careful, however, once history is written it's not that easily undone.

The main story line of the game is already completed and will be comprised of chapters with clear starts and ends. Player characters are encouraged to get involved with the already written plot and to make sub-plots. As it is written, the game has threads and will play out as a sort of “choose your own adventure” depending on the player character's choices. The pace of the game's main story line is going to be slow to medium, depending on how threading and CR is going.
